10 Best Dress Shoes Every Man Should Own

Businessman clothes shoes, man getting ready for work, morning groom before wedding ceremony

Being able to present a well-groomed appearance is a valuable life skill that every man should have in his arsenal. Whether you’re dressing for a job interview, a formal function, or even a date, being able to look the part is essential to success. While your clothes are naturally an important part of how you present yourself, your shoes are just as important. A man’s shoes say a lot about him whether he likes it or not, so choosing the right shoes is crucial to project the right image. We’ve compiled the best dress shoes for men that every man should own.


The Oxford is a classic men’s dress shoe that belongs in every man’s wardrobe. It can be identified by its closed lacing system, which features stitching on the bottom. Oxfords also tend to feature a low heel and a short back, creating a polished and polished appearance. Perfect for teaming up with a suit, Oxfords are a reliable choice for any formal occasion. While black and polished styles work easily for the highest dress codes, other varieties of Oxfords can suit any number of events.

Oxford dress shoes


2. Richelieu

Brogues can be a deceptive type of shoe. The name actually comes from the process of broguing, which involves adorning shoes with heavy perforations (large stitching). As such, shoes that are technically of another style, such as Oxfords or Derbys, are often classified as Brogues due to this decorative addition. Confusing or not, the unique look creates a shoe with personality and style. Best of all, they can be worn with anything from jeans to suits.

Dress Brogues



Like Oxfords, Derby shoes are another common type of dress shoe. Slightly less complex in design, however, derbies feature an open lacing system, unlike oxfords which have the bottom of the lacing section sewn closed. The comfortable style is suitable for most formal occasions and can easily be paired with a suit. While the traditional varieties of leather Derby shoes are perfect for a classic and refined look, other types, in materials such as suede, are ideal for a slightly more casual look.

Men's derby shoes


4. Monk strap

The buckle shoe is an elegant and unique dress shoe. Featuring a top strap and a buckle (or two), the sleek design can be worn with a number of formal looks for everything from a business meeting to a night out. The popular and fashionable shoe is also a great choice for men looking for a refined style with more interest than the standard Oxford or Derby. Just be sure to choose a leather style with a bit of sheen to keep the look refined and suitably crisp.

Monk Dress Shoes


5. Moccasin

Moccasins are slip-on shoes often featuring moccasin-style construction. The comfortable slip-on shoe is perfect for adding an elegant and casual touch to formal outfits. Although loafers can work with a number of looks, they pair perfectly with suits, especially those worn with highlights. Choose between varieties such as classic penny loafers and leather tassel loafers for a unique and dapper look. If you really want to impress, however, a decadent pair of velvet loafers will undoubtedly do the trick.

Loafers Dress Shoes


7. Chelsea Boot

When you think of dress shoes, you might not immediately think of boots, but maybe you should. After all, the right style of boot can give men a nice finishing touch to formal looks. Chelsea boots are one such style and can be paired with everything from casual looks to cocktail attire. Round toe ankle boots feature elasticated sides that make them easy to slip on and off without laces or buckles. Ditching those traditional ties allows the Chelsea to create a super sleek and streamlined look.

Chealse Dress Shoes


8. Lace-up boot

Dress boots are another style of boots that can be worn dressed up. Unlike Chelsea boots, dress boots have a lace-up front and finish above the ankle. The slim style projects a subtle utilitarian vibe and offers a slight edge to outfits. Perfect for pairing with casual evening outfits and smart weekend outfits, dress boots look best in black or brown leather and will add a lot of interest to your outfit.



9. Chukka Boot

Chukka boots are a comfortable style of dress boots that end at the ankle. Their shorter height means they feature minimal lacing, creating a simple appearance. It is this simple yet sharp style that also makes chukka boots ideal for casual and semi-formal dress codes. Although the style sometimes appears in traditional leather, it is most often presented in suede, which also adds to the casual image of the shoe.

Men's Chukka Boots


10. Sandal

When it comes to summer, you don’t have to sweat your feet just to look smart. While flip flops are undoubtedly an inappropriate choice for formal and dressy occasions, a nice pair of sandals may be just what your outfit needs. While you can’t pair them with a black tie function, you can wear a pair to smart casual events and general weekend gatherings where you want to look your best. Just look for unique and stylish varieties of leather to make your outfit work.

Dress Sandals



What are the best dress shoes for men?

When it comes to formal dress shoes for men, you’ll want to invest in a pair of oxford, brogue, derby or monk strap shoes, preferably in high shine leather. Oxfords are the dressiest of these styles. If you’re looking for men’s dress boots, Chelsea, lace-ups, and chukkas are all great options that work with a range of outfits. Finally, loafers and sandals are excellent choices for less formal occasions.

What are men’s dress shoes called?

When someone talks about dress shoes for men, they are most likely talking about Oxfords, the most formal design. Other styles include brogue, derby and monk strap. They are all similar to oxfords, with differences in details, closures and heel height.

How should men take care of dress shoes?

If your dress shoes are leather, you’ll need to start by wiping off any excess dirt with a soft cloth. Next, apply polish in a matching color and use a horsehair brush to remove excess polish. Achieve an extra shine by applying a drop of water to the leather and buffing vigorously with a cloth, repeating throughout. This is commonly referred to as a “pin chip”. As for suede shoes, use a suede brush to remove dirt and revive the nap. Then finish with a few coats of waterproofer to prevent future damage. Finally, always store your shoes in a clean, dry environment, protected from the weather.


Subscribe to our mailing list and get interesting news and updates delivered to your inbox.

Thank you for subscribing.

Something went wrong.

Related Posts